PHP WordPress Plugin Fejlesztés Útmutató.

A WordPress PHP plugin-ek titkai: hogyan emeljük SEO rangsorolásunkat?

A modern webfejlesztés egyik meghatározó platformja a WordPress, mely világszerte az internet jelentős részét működteti. Alapvető erőssége a rugalmasság és a testreszabhatóság, amit nem kis részben a PHP nyelven írt plugin-oknak köszönhet. Ma betekintést nyerünk abba, hogyan használhatjuk ki ezeket az eszközöket a keresőoptimalizálás (SEO) szolgálatában.

A PHP: a WordPress dinamikus motorja

A WordPress magja PHP nyelven készült, ami egy szerveroldali szkriptnyelv. Ez azt jelenti, hogy a kód a szerveren fut, és dinamikus HTML tartalmat generál a felhasználónak. Egy jó minőségű, hatékonyan írt PHP plugin nemcsak új funkcionalitást ad a weboldalunkhoz, hanem gyorsaságot és megbízhatóságot is. A lapbetöltési sebesség egy elsődleges SEO faktor, így a plugin kódjának optimalizálása kiemelt fontosságú. A felesleges lekérdezések, a nem optimalizált adatbázis-hívások jelentősen lassíthatják oldalunkat, ami negatívan hat a rangsorolásra.

A plugin: a funkcionalitás építőköve

A WordPress plugin-ek lényegében PHP fájlok vagy fájlok gyűjteményei, melyek egy specifikus funkcióval bővítik a rendszert. Egy jól megtervezett SEO plugin – mint például a Yoast SEO vagy a Rank Math – alapvető struktúrát biztosít: lehetővé teszi a meta cím és leírás szerkesztését, létrehozza az XML oldaltérképet, kezeli a nyílt gráf (Open Graph) adatokat, és segít a tartalom elemzésében. Ezek a technikai alapok nélkülözhetetlenek a keresőmotorok számára történő megfelelő indexeléshez. Fontos azonban, hogy ne terjesszük túl a plugin-ok számát, mert a konfliktusok és a teljesítménycsökkenés gyakori problémák lehetnek.

A három kulcsfontosságú összefüggés: PHP, WordPress, SEO

A siker kulcsa a harmóniában rejlik. Egy egyedi PHP plugin fejlesztése lehetővé teszi, hogy pontosan azokat a SEO igényeket támasztjuk alá, amelyekre a weboldalunknak szüksége van. Például készíthetünk egy olyan megoldást, amely automatikusan optimalizálja a képeket, generálja a séma jelölésű (Schema Markup) adatokat termékekhez, vagy kezeli a speciális tartalomtípusokat (Custom Post Types) ideális URL szerkezettel. A WordPress rendkívül rugalmas keretrendszert biztosít ehhez a fejlesztéshez, a lehetőségek szinte végtelenek. A lényeg, hogy a kód tiszta, biztonságos és követi a WordPress fejlesztési ajánlásait.

Gyakorlati lépések a fejlesztéshez

Ha úgy döntünk, hogy saját SEO plugin-t fejlesztünk, számos tényezőre kell odafigyelni. A kódunkat érdemes modulárisan, objektum-orientált PHP-ban írni, hogy könnyen karbantartható legyen. Használjuk a WordPress beépített függvényeit és hook-jait (akciók és szűrők), hogy zökkenőmentesen integrálódjunk a rendszerbe. Ne felejtsük el a biztonságot: minden felhasználói bemenetet validálni és sanitizálni kell. Végül, de nem utolsósorban, teszteljük alaposan a plugin-t különböző környezetekben, hogy biztosítsuk a kompatibilitást és a stabil működést.

Összegzés: az eszköz a kezünkben

A WordPress és PHP kombinációja hatalmas erőt ad a webfejlesztők kezébe. Egy jól megírt, SEO-centrikus plugin nem csupán egy kényelmi funkció, hanem stratégiai befektetés a weboldal hosszú távú sikerébe. A lényeg, hogy a technikai megvalósítás – a gyorsaság, a tiszta kód, a jó felhasználói élmény – szolgálja a tartalmi minőséget és a felhasználói szándékot. Így a keresőmotorok is jobban értékelni fogják oldalunkat, ami végül több organikus forgalomhoz és jobb láthatósághoz vezet. Fejlesszünk okosan, a felhasználó és a kereső szemével egyaránt.

Image source:Unsplash